What does a part-time LCSW do?

A part-time licensed clinical social worker (LCSW) works fewer than 35 hours per week to provide mental health services on a case by case basis. Your responsibilities are to meet with each client to provide a mental health assessment, offer support to the client through counseling and connection to community resources, and design an ongoing treatment plan for the client to improve their mental health. Your duties may also include contacting emergency services if you believe a client needs further help, working with health insurance companies to develop mental health services, and cooperating with social services and court cases when necessary.

What is a part-time LCSW?

Part-time LCSWs, or Licensed Clinical Social Workers, are mental health professionals who work less than full-time hours, typically providing therapy, counseling, and support services to individuals, families, or groups. They are licensed to diagnose and treat mental, behavioral, and emotional issues, often working in healthcare settings, private practices, schools, or community organizations. Working part-time allows LCSWs flexibility in their schedules while still fulfilling licensure requirements and making a meaningful impact in their clients’ lives.

What are some common challenges faced by part-time LCSWs and how can they be managed?

Part-time Licensed Clinical Social Workers (LCSWs) often face challenges such as balancing a limited schedule with client needs, managing caseloads efficiently, and ensuring continuity of care. Communication with supervisors and colleagues is crucial to coordinate client coverage and maintain high-quality services. Setting clear boundaries for availability and maintaining thorough documentation can help address these challenges, allowing part-time LCSWs to provide effective support while managing their workload.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part-time LCSW,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time LCSW (Licensed Clinical Social Worker), you need a master's degree in social work, state licensure, and experience in clinical assessment and therapeutic intervention.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R), telehealth platforms, and standardized assessment tools is often required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, cultural competence, and strong boundaries are vital soft skills for building trust and supporting clients effectively. These competencies ensure ethical, effective care and maximize client outcomes while meeting professional standards within a flexible work schedule.

What is the difference between Part Time Lcsw vs Part Time Licensed Professional Counselor?

AspectPart Time LcswPart Time Licensed Professional Counselor
CredentialsRequires LCSW license, master's in social workRequires LPC license, master's in counseling or psychology
Work EnvironmentClinics, hospitals, community agenciesPrivate practices, mental health clinics, schools
Employer & IndustryHealthcare, social servicesMental health services, counseling centers
Common Search/ComparisonOften compared for mental health rolesSimilar client services, different licensing

Both Part Time Lcsw and Part Time Licensed Professional Counselor roles involve providing mental health services, but they differ mainly in licensing requirements and typical work settings. LCSWs have a social work background and may work in broader social services, while LPCs focus specifically on counseling.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right part-time mental health career path.

Responsibilities

What you will do: (responsibilities listed are included but not limited to)

  • Performs comprehensive evaluations, assessing the social, emotional and support needs of the patients and their families
  • Sets measurable objectives that are formulated in conjunction with the rehab team
  • Assists the physician and other health team members in understanding the significant social and emotional factors related to the patient's health problems
  • Instructs/counsels’ patients and families in treating and coping with social and emotional response connected with illnesses
  • Participates in care coordination activities and acts as a resource to other health team members in the identification and resolution of patient needs
  • Identifies and assists the patient/ and or family to utilize appropriate community resources to achieve measurable objectives

Qualifications

What you’ll need:

  • Master's Degree in Clinical Social Work (LCSW)
  • Current Licensed Clinical Social Worker Licensure in the state of practice
  • Minimum of one year experience in a rehabilitation setting serving individuals who have experienced a traumatic brain injury, spinal cord injury or acute diagnosis
  • CPR certification required
  • Ability to lift 50 pounds
  • Moving,lifting,or transferring of patients which may involve lifting of up to 100 pounds following safety procedures
  • Duties require fine motor skills,visual acuity, and walking/ standing for extended periods
  • Additional physical requirements include:pushing/pulling, bending/stooping, reaching, kneeling, and positioning frequently at times
